After failing to score in their last match, Alisal made sure to put some goals up on the board against Monte Vista Christian on Wednesday. They blew past the Monte Vista Christian Mustangs 4-1. Considering the Trojans' offense had been struggling lately, the high-scoring outing was a much-needed turnaround.
Stephanie Zarate and Massiel Hernandez scored all four of Alisal's goals, bringing their combined season tally to 18 goals.
Alisal's win bumped their record up to 7-8-2. As for Monte Vista Christian, their loss was their third straight on the road, which dropped their record down to 4-9-3.
